(RepublicanJournal.org) – The gender debate has been reaching various spiritual communities in recent years and causing them to split over differing LGBTQ ideology. In Great Britain, the Church of England recently met to discuss this issue, voting to allow clergy to perform blessings for same-sex couples but not to marry them in the church. Russian President Vladimir Putin used this decision to attack the West in his latest speech, which came just days ahead of his one-year anniversary of invading Ukraine.

Putin Rallies Against the West for Its Spiritual Beliefs

On Tuesday, February 21, Putin spoke to his nation’s lawmakers and top military officials about his ongoing war in Ukraine. He used this time to change his rhetoric around the drawn-out battle from being solely against Ukraine to against all of Western civilization. According to a translation by The Telegraph, the Russian leader pointed out that “the Anglican Church plans to consider the idea of a gender-neutral God,” which he believes will end with “a real spiritual catastrophe.”

While the Church of England has only officially moved to bless same-sex couples, it also announced that church leaders will begin to study gender use when referring to God. Progressives are calling for the end of solely male pronouns in liturgical practices. Bishops will decide whether or not to reference God as gender neutral, consider female alternatives, and discuss whether the use of “Father” is appropriate during services.

Putin Turns War in Ukraine Into War Against the West

During his speech, Putin also accused the West of starting the war. According to the Daily Mail, the Russian president placed “responsibility for fueling the Ukrainian conflict, for its escalation, for the number of victims” fully on “Western elites.” He blamed western nations for attacking his country’s culture, religion, and family structure through the progressive values pushed across much of the West.

He used this nearly two-hour talk to officially announce he was suspending Russia from further participation in the New START Treaty, which was a 2009 agreement between the US and Russia to limit the amount of nuclear material each nation would produce. The American Enterprise Institute’s Russia expert, Leon Aron, told The Hill that this nuclear threat is likely the last bargaining chip that Putin has to try and influence the war in Ukraine and his relationship with NATO and the US.

Putin appears to be framing his war as an attack on the Russian way of life in order to try and rally support from both citizens and keep support from his officials. Without it, the Russian leader could quickly lose his power and grip over the nation, and no one quite knows what would happen if that took place.
